An Integrative Eight-Dimensional Nonlinear Dynamical Model for Polycystic Ovary Syndrome Management: First-Principles Derivation, Global Asymptotic Stability Analysis, Optimal Control, Bayesian Inference, Sensitivity Analysis, and Translational Framework

Pol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S) is the most prevalent heterogeneous endocrine-metabolic-reproductive disorder among reproductive-age women, with a global prevalence of 8--13\% and substantial phenotypic variability across ethnic groups and diagnostic criteria (Rotterdam, NIH, AES) \citep{Teede2018, Teede2023, Azziz2016}. The syndrome is mechanistically driven by intertwined hyperandrogenism, insulin resistance (affecting 50--90\% of patients), ovulatory dysfunction, polycystic ovarian morphology, chronic low-grade systemic inflammation, hypothalamic-pituitary-ovarian axis dysregulation, and gut microbiome dysbiosis characterized by reduced Shannon diversity, depleted SCFA-producing taxa, and altered bile-acid metabolism \citep{Teede2018, Qi2019, Torres2018, Lindheim2017}. Conventional mono-therapeutic or dual-axis strategies (lifestyle modification, metformin, clomiphene citrate, letrozole, oral contraceptives) achieve remission rates of 40--66\% and fertility restoration below 60\%, with high relapse upon discontinuation and limited impact on long-term cardiometabolic risk \citep{Teede2018, Legro2014, Thessaloniki2008}. Recent causal evidence from fecal microbiota transplantation (FMT) in germ-free and antibiotic-treated rodent models demonstrates that transplantation of PCOS-patient-derived microbiota can induce metabolic dysfunction and ovarian abnormalities, while healthy microbiota transplantation shows therapeutic potential \citep{Qi2019, Torres2018, Lindheim2017}. Nutrigenomic and untargeted metabolomic investigations reveal gene--diet interactions involving variants in \textit{INSR}, \textit{CYP11A1}, \textit{FTO}, and \textit{PPARG}, along with consistent perturbations in branched-chain amino acids, aromatic amino acids, pyruvate, lactate, bile acids, and lipid subclasses that sustain a self-reinforcing disease state \citep{Insenser2018, Zhao2020, Escobar-Morreale2018}. Systems-biology network pharmacology has identified multi-target hubs converging on PI3K/Akt/mTOR, TNF-\alpha/NF-\kappaB, PPAR-\gamma, and AMPK pathways \citep{Zhang2020, Wang2019, Liu2021}. Previous dynamical-systems approaches have employed stochastic ODEs, fractional-order models, and semi-mechanistic frameworks, but these remain limited in scope and lack explicit multi-disciplinary control integration \citep{Mari2019, Bergman2019, Cobelli2019}. Artificial-intelligence applications achieve high diagnostic accuracy but have not been embedded within closed-loop control architectures \citep{Dalmia2021, Ghosh2022, Bhardwaj2020}.This study develops an eight-dimensional nonlinear ordinary differential equation (ODE) model that integrates precision endocrinology, nutrigenomics and metabolomics, gut microbiome engineering, systems-biology network pharmacology, and AI-driven reinforcement-learning personalization into a single closed-loop framework. The model is derived from first principles of mass-action kinetics and Hill-type receptor cooperativity, with explicit state vector \mathbf{x}(t) = [A,I,E,O,M,H,C,D]^\top representing normalized androgen, insulin, estrogen, ovulation index, microbiome Shannon diversity, hypothalamic GnRH pulse frequency, systemic inflammation index, and adiposity index, respectively. The control matrix \mathbf{B} \in \mathbb{R}^{8 \times 8} (Table~\ref{tab:B}) maps each disciplinary intervention to state perturbations. All 32 model parameters are sourced exclusively from published meta-analyses, human cohort studies, and mechanistic experiments, with explicit uncertainty ranges for sensitivity testing. Existence, uniqueness, and continuous dependence of solutions are guaranteed by the Picard--Lindelöf theorem on the compact positively invariant domain \mathcal{D} = [0,2]^8. Global asymptotic stability of the healthy attractor \mathbf{x}^* is rigorously proven via the direct Lyapunov method, with complete algebraic derivation of \dot{V} and explicit bounding of all nonlinear cross-terms. Optimal control trajectories are synthesized via Pontryagin's minimum principle, and reinforcement learning is employed for real-time personalization of the AI-driven control input. Hierarchical Bayesian inference with literature-anchored priors, global Sobol sensitivity analysis, stochastic extension via Itô calculus, and structural identifiability analysis via differential algebra are provided. The complete, reproducible Python 3.12 implementation is embedded. \textbf{Critical transparency statement:} This model is purely theoretical and computational; all predictions are derived from in-silico simulations calibrated to published literature parameters. Prospective clinical validation with real patient data constitutes essential future work before any translational application.
